Indirect competitors are your industry
Venture Capital.
ICOs have already eclipsed seed/angel round VC funding. What will happen when they are ready for an A round in 18 moths? I suspect they will be able to tap into their reserve of tokens. This coupled with the explosive growth of ICOs will potentially decimate allow ICOs to eclipse early-round VC funding (I give it 12 months actually).
What will have to happen?
VCs use ICOs to raise funds
VCs use ICOs to help mid stage portfolio companies to do reverse ICOs
VCs invest in ICOs
VCs present another value add by advising ICOs.
#3, and 4 are already happening.
ZILLA can help with 1, 2, and 3.
